Understanding Risk and Reward in Aviator Games

At the heart of aviator lies a delicate balance between risk and reward. The fundamental principle is straightforward: the longer you wait to cash out, the higher your potential multiplier, but also the greater the chance the plane will crash, resulting in a loss of your stake. This creates a compelling psychological dynamic, forcing players to weigh their desire for larger winnings against the inherent risk of losing everything. Successful players aren't simply relying on luck; they are implementing strategies to manage their bankroll and consistently extract profits. A core component of these strategies involves understanding probability and recognizing when to take a conservative approach versus when to push for a larger payout. The game’s random number generator (RNG) dictates the crash point, making it impossible to predict with certainty, which is why disciplined bankroll management is paramount.

The Importance of Bankroll Management

Effective bankroll management is arguably the single most important aspect of playing aviator. It’s about protecting your capital and ensuring you can withstand a series of losses without depleting your funds. A common strategy is to start with small bets – typically 1-2% of your total bankroll – and gradually increase them as you accumulate winnings. This conservative approach allows you to weather losing streaks and continue playing. Furthermore, setting profit targets and stop-loss limits is crucial. Once you reach your desired profit level, cash out and walk away. Similarly, if you hit your pre-determined loss limit, stop playing and reassess your strategy. Avoid the temptation to chase losses, as this can quickly lead to significant financial setbacks. Treating aviator as a form of entertainment with a defined budget, rather than a guaranteed income source, is a healthy mindset.

Strategies for Cashing Out in Aviator

While the outcome of each aviator round is ultimately determined by chance, there are several strategies players employ to increase their chances of cashing out with a profit. One popular approach is the "single bet" strategy, where players place a single bet per round and aim to cash out at a predetermined multiplier, such as 1.5x or 2x. This is a relatively conservative strategy that prioritizes consistency and minimizes risk. Another strategy is the "double bet" or "martingale" strategy, where players double their bet after each loss, hoping to recoup their losses with a single win. This strategy can be risky, as it requires a substantial bankroll and can lead to significant losses if you encounter a prolonged losing streak. A more sophisticated approach involves analyzing past game data (if available) and identifying patterns in crash points, though it's important to remember that past performance is not indicative of future results.

Automated Cashing Out and Bots

Many aviator platforms offer an auto-cashout feature, which allows players to set a target multiplier and automatically cash out their bet when the aircraft reaches that level. This is a valuable tool for players who want to avoid the pressure of manually timing their cashout and ensure they don't miss out on potential profits. However, it's important to use this feature cautiously, as it can also lead to missed opportunities if the aircraft continues to climb beyond your target multiplier. There's also a market for "aviator bots" that claim to predict crash points and automatically cash out at optimal times. While some of these bots may be legitimate, many are scams or are simply ineffective. Relying on bots is generally not recommended, as they cannot guarantee profits and can potentially expose you to security risks.
